I have spent much of my life fighting the Germans and fighting the politicians. It is much easier to fight the Germans.

Lord Montgomery (1887–1976), British field marshal, In The Times, 15 May 1967, Jay p.265

What is the worst example of political fighting you can recall? Was anyone killed? Permanently injured? Were you a witness, or a participant? What did the experience teach you?

Bernard Montgomery was one of the greatest generals—and hyperbolists—of recent times.
